Italy Wins Euro 2020! England, I Told You So…

Sunday, July 11, 2021 at 6:47 PM
Written by Anthony L. Hall

Given Brexit, it’s arguable that England has not suffered a more symbolic defeat since the Norman Conquest than the one Italy handed it today. Two soccer-mad nations faced each other, and one blinked. Italy bested England in the final of the Euro 2020 soccer tournament Sunday in London. The winner was determined by a penalty… Read more.

EU: Britain Trying to Have Its Cake and Eat It Too

Tuesday, January 29, 2013 at 6:45 AM
Written by Anthony L. Hall

Public disillusionment in Britain with the European Union is such that Prime Minister David Cameron felt compelled last Wednesday to pledge to hold an “in-out referendum” on UK membership if he is re-elected in 2015. The next Conservative manifesto in 2015 will ask for a mandate from the British people for a Conservative government to… Read more.
